Expectations
- Take control of office processes, equipment monitoring, and workstation support to enhance service efficiency.
- Handle general office needs, from booking meeting rooms to liaising with building reception.
- Keep a 'live' hardware log, tracking IT equipment and strategising for productivity improvement.
- Manage the hardware lifecycle, arranging repairs, renewals, and recycling.
- Administer the shared Operations help desk, ensuring tasks are completed within agreed service level agreements.
- Assist with logistics for congress attendance, bookings, and facilitation.
- Support other administrative duties under the guidance of the Operations Lead.

Key Information
- Salary: £25,000 per annum
- Hours: 8.30am – 5pm, Mon-Fri
- Working pattern: This is a full-time office based role
- Location: Moorgate, London
- Application deadline: Monday 4th December

About EMJ
We publish high-quality, peer-reviewed, open-access digital journals six weeks after each major medical congress across a wide range of therapeutic areas. They encapsulate the latest developments with treatments in the pharmaceutical industry, making our publications an essential must-read for healthcare professionals, medical practitioners, physicians, clinicians and leading industry professionals.
